UK Innovator Founder Visa for Students: Britain Approves On-Shore Switch for International Graduates from 2025

The United Kingdom is preparing for one of its most transformative immigration changes in recent memory. Beginning 25 November 2025, international students will be permitted to switch directly to the UK Innovator Founder Visa for Students without returning to their home countries—an overhaul that rewrites a long-standing rule and signals a bold shift in Britain’s strategy to retain high-potential global graduates.

For years, the requirement to exit the UK before reapplying discouraged many student innovators from planting their entrepreneurial roots in Britain. Promising founders often returned home only to continue their careers elsewhere, resulting in a brain drain at the moment when their ideas were most ready to evolve.

This time, the UK is clearly repositioning itself. Officials state that the new rule is part of a deliberate push to ensure that students who arrive with talent leave as entrepreneurs, not missed opportunities. Any international student currently holding a valid Study visa will now be eligible to apply for the Innovator Founder route from within the country—no departure, no re-entry, and no bureaucratic detours.

What the UK Innovator Founder Visa for Students Is Designed For

At its core, the Innovator Founder visa is reserved for individuals who want to build an innovative, market-shifting business in Britain. The proposed idea must be original, commercially promising, and capable of scaling. To ensure quality and legitimacy, each business idea must be endorsed by an approved endorsing body—organisations appointed by the UK government to evaluate entrepreneurial potential.

Formerly known simply as the Innovator visa, this updated route provides far more flexibility, especially for early-stage founders who need room to experiment and grow without excessive financial barriers.

Eligibility Requirements for Switching to the Innovator Founder Route

Students aiming to transition to the Innovator Founder route must first have their business idea assessed. If the endorsing body confirms that the idea meets the pillars of innovation, viability, and scalability, the applicant receives an official endorsement letter.

Applicants must also:

  • Be 18 years or older

  • Meet the English language requirement

  • Show sufficient personal savings to support themselves

  • Provide evidence of funding sources for new business ventures

  • Ensure their business plan is credible and entrepreneur-led

If the business is already endorsed under a previous visa, or if modifications have been approved by the endorsing body, additional investment funds may not be required.

Financial Requirements

Applicants must demonstrate that they have maintained at least £1,270 in personal savings for 28 consecutive days prior to applying. These funds must be personal—not investment capital or earnings from unauthorised work.

UK Innovator Founder Visa: Meeting the English Language Requirement

English proficiency must be proven through either:

  • A government-approved English language test

  • An English-taught academic qualification

  • Nationality from an English-speaking country

This ensures that founders can run their businesses, collaborate, and communicate effectively within the UK’s professional environment.

Length of Stay and Extension Rules

The Innovator Founder visa grants permission to stay for up to three years. Within that time, founders must meet their endorsing body at:

  • 12 months

  • 24 months

These check-ins determine whether the business is progressing. If the endorsing body withdraws support, the visa may be shortened.

Holders can extend their visa in three-year increments, with no limit on extensions. Crucially, after three years, applicants may become eligible to apply for Indefinite Leave to Remain (ILR)—a direct route to settlement.

Understanding the Application Process

Applications must be submitted online and differ based on location:

  1. Outside the UK – Applying to enter

  2. Inside the UK – Extending an existing visa

  3. Inside the UK – Switching from another visa category (including Study visas under the new rule)

Dependants—partners and children—can accompany applicants if they meet eligibility rules.

Processing Timelines

Typical decision times after identity verification and document submission:

  • 3 weeks when applying from outside the UK

  • 8 weeks when switching or extending within the UK

Priority processing may be available for an extra fee.

Costs Applicants Must Budget For

A complete breakdown of fees for the Innovator Founder route includes:

  • £1,274 per person (applications from outside the UK)

  • £1,590 per person (applications within the UK)

  • £1,000 for endorsement by an approved body

  • £500 per required check-in meeting (minimum two)

  • Healthcare surcharge (paid separately)

  • Biometric enrolment, free of charge

These fees ensure applicants understand the total financial commitment involved in starting a business in the UK.
